Urbandale Community School District is a public school district headquartered in Urbandale, Iowa. It serves a portion of the Urbandale city limits, [ 2 ] and is entirely in Polk County . [ 3 ]
The first year of high school education in Urbandale was the 1936–1937 school year. [4] A gymnasium with a stage was completed in 1940 with Works Progress Administration funding. [ 4 ] A new building was finished in 1963, with additions in 1978 and 1981.

Since its founding, the Central Iowa Metro League was a league composed of metropolitan schools in central Iowa. The conference, for many years, consisted of just 14 schools: the 5 Des Moines schools, Ankeny, Ames, Valley, Dowling, Indianola, Marshalltown, Southeast Polk, Newton and Urbandale.
Johnston Community School District (JCSD) is a school district headquartered in Johnston, Iowa. In 2023, Nikki Roorda became the superintendent. [3] The district, with 40 square miles (100 km 2), [4] is located in Polk County. [5] It serves Johnston and portions of Des Moines, Granger, Grimes, and Urbandale. Waukee Community School District (WCSD) is a public school district headquartered in Waukee, Iowa. [2] Entirely in Dallas County, it serves Waukee and portions of Clive, Urbandale and West Des Moines. [3] As of 2015 it is the fastest growing school district in the state. [2]
